Memory of Fallen SLA War Heroes Revered in Anniversary Commemorative Ceremonies

Sri Lanka Artillery Regiment (SLA), one of the most prestigious and reputed regiments in the Army launched a series of commemorative events on Monday (20) in connection with its founding day and 127th anniversary, beginning from its Panagoda SLA Regimental Headquarters.

Lieutenant General Crishanthe De Silva, Commander of the Army as the Chief Guest at the invitation of the SLA Colonel Commandant, Major General Lal Perera joined the inaugural segment of the anniversary events, in which the pride of place, went to the commemoration of fallen SLA War Heroes.

The day’s ceremony of the ‘Gunners’ included a special tribute to the fallen War Heroes, floral-wreath laying and a minute’s silence in honour of fallen War Heroes at the SLA monument by both the Chief Guest, relatives of all fallen SLA War Heroes and attendees, salute to the National Anthem and the Regimental Song, Religious observances of all denominations, etc. The Commander’s arrival was greeted with a formal Guard Turn Out at the entrance to the premises.
               
Major General Lal Perera welcomed the Chief Guest on arrival at the Regimental Centre premises.

The SLA monument was afterwards revered by SLA Colonel Commandant, SLA Brigade Commander, SLA Centre Commandant, and representatives of retired SLA veterans, SLA Unit Commanders, Commandant, SLA Training School and Regimental Warrant Officers in succession soon after the first floral wreath was laid by the day’s Chief Guest.

An all night Pirith chanting ceremony Monday (20) evening, followed by ‘Heel Daana’, was to bring the day’s anniversary programmes to an end.  

Many retired SLA officers, serving officers, relatives of fallen SLA War Heroes and a large gathering attended the inaugural commemorative ceremonies.

Lieutenant General Crishanthe De Silva, seconds after wreath-laying closely went through the names inscribed on the monument and refreshed his memories, sharing a couple of thoughts with accompanying SLA Colonel Commandant and other senior officers.
